Play, practice, or train? 

Simple concepts we all understand, but what are their differences and when should you be doing each one? On this episode, we break that down. 

This idea is based on an article, Gray wrote years ago, that still rings true.

First, we cover the basics, and Gray uses his kettlebell journey with Brett Jones as an example.

We talk cartwheels, tennis, South American football drills, martial arts, and how this topic applies to youth sports. Gray and Lee also give us an idea of what play looks like at their house.

For the pros, we get into coaching strategies, working around people’s limitations, and small group fitness options.
